January 2026 Begins With Realme 16 Pro Series

The first major launch of 2026 is expected from Realme, which is set to introduce the Realme 16 Pro Series in India on January 6. The lineup will include two models, Realme 16 Pro and Realme 16 Pro Plus. Both devices are confirmed to feature a 200MP primary rear camera supported by LumaColor Image technology. A standout highlight is the periscope telephoto camera that will allow up to 10x optical zoom, aiming to redefine smartphone photography in this segment. Alongside hardware improvements, Realme will also introduce advanced photo editing capabilities through AI Edit Genie 2.0, bringing features like StyleMe and LightMe for enhanced image personalization.

Redmi Note 15 Launches Alongside Realme

On the same day, Xiaomi is expected to unveil the Redmi Note 15 for Indian consumers. This smartphone will be available via online platforms and is designed to strengthen the brand’s presence in the competitive mid-range market. According to official listings, the Redmi Note 15 will sport a 6.77-inch curved AMOLED display, delivering immersive visuals. The camera setup includes a 108MP sensor with optical image stabilization and 4K video recording support. Powering the device will be the Snapdragon 6 Gen 3 chipset, making it suitable for multitasking, gaming, and long-term performance reliability.

Poco M8 5G Targets Budget Buyers

Poco, a sub-brand of Xiaomi, is also gearing up for a January 8 launch with the Poco M8 5G. This smartphone is expected to focus on slim design and lightweight build, measuring just 7.35mm in thickness and weighing around 178 grams. While detailed specifications are still under wraps, industry reports suggest that the device could share design cues and internal hardware similarities with the Redmi Note 15. The Poco M8 5G is likely to appeal to users looking for a stylish yet affordable 5G smartphone.

Oppo Reno 15 Series Joins the January Lineup

Oppo is also preparing to expand its popular Reno lineup with the Oppo Reno 15 Series. Although the official launch date has not been disclosed, teasers suggest a January release. The series is expected to include three variants: Reno 15, Reno 15 Pro, and Reno 15 Mini. One of the biggest highlights will be the introduction of HoloFusion design technology, making it the first smartphone series in India to feature this new visual approach. Oppo is likely to continue its focus on camera quality and premium aesthetics.

Xiaomi 17 Series Expected Later in the Year

Beyond January, Xiaomi is reportedly working on its next flagship lineup, the Xiaomi 17 Series. Leaks indicate that the series may consist of four models: Xiaomi 17, Xiaomi 17 Pro, Xiaomi 17 Ultra, and Xiaomi 17 Pro Max. While the company has not confirmed the Indian launch timeline, these devices are expected to bring high-end processors, upgraded camera sensors, and refined software experiences aimed at premium users.

Samsung Galaxy S26 Series Could Arrive in February

Samsung traditionally kicks off its flagship cycle early in the year, and 2026 should be no different. The Galaxy S26 Series is rumored to launch in February. Industry leaks suggest notable camera upgrades and deeper AI-driven enhancements across the lineup. The Ultra variant is once again expected to feature a 200MP primary camera, reinforcing Samsung’s leadership in mobile imaging technology.

Google Pixel 11 Series in Mid-2026

Mid-year 2026 may see the arrival of the Pixel 11 Series from Google. Expected models include Pixel 11, Pixel 11 Pro, and Pixel 11 Pro XL, with speculation around a Pixel 11 Fold as well. Known for clean software and advanced computational photography, the Pixel lineup is likely to continue emphasizing AI-powered camera processing and long-term software support.

iPhone 18 Series Could Be the Biggest Launch of 2026

As always, the most anticipated launch of the year could come from Apple. The iPhone 18 Series is expected to debut in September 2026, continuing Apple’s annual release cycle. While official details are unavailable, the new series is likely to introduce hardware refinements, improved efficiency, and deeper ecosystem integration, making it a major attraction for premium smartphone buyers.
